My client is seeking a skilled and motivated Fire & Security Engineer to join a growing team. This role involves working across a range of fire protection and electronic security systems, ensuring installations, maintenance, and servicing are carried out to the highest stand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Install, inspect, and maintain fire protection and electronic security systems.
- Ensure compliance with relevant regulations and standards.
- Provide excellent customer service and support.
Salary: Up to £42,000 (dependent on experience)
Location: London/Surrey based

How to prepare for a job interview at Mulberry Recruitment
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you’re well-versed in fire protection and electronic security systems. Brush up on the latest technologies and regulations in the industry, as this will show your potential employer that you’re serious about the role.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are specific examples from your past work that highlight your skills in installation, maintenance, and servicing of fire and security systems.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ers effectively.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Come prepared with insightful questions about the company’s projects, team dynamics, or future goals.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
✨Dress the Part
While it’s important to be comfortable, make sure you dress professionally for the interview. A smart appearance can create a positive first impression and reflect your seriousness about the position.
